Gypsum is a soft sulfate mineral composed of calcium sulfate dihydrate, with the chemical formula CaSO 4 ·2H 2 O. It is widely mined and is used as a fertilizer and as the main constituent in many forms of plaster, blackboard/sidewalk chalk, and massive finegrained white or lightly tinted variety of gypsum, called alabaster, has been used for sculpture by many cultures including ...

Gypsum slurry mostly dewatered by a twostage process: 1. Slurry is prethickened and partly classified by a set of hydrocyclones in first step. Though not very common, static thickeners can be used alternatively. 2. Further dewatering and cake washing in second step. water content of commercial grade gypsum needs to be below 10% wt.

The mixing of sulfuric acid and phosphate creates gypsum (called phosphogypsum) as a byproduct. Although gypsum can be used for a variety of purposes, the EPA prevents usage of Florida''s phosphogypsum because it retains low levels of radioactivity found in the host sediments. At present, phosphogypsum is piled up around the processing plant.

Gypsum, one of the most widely used minerals in the world, literally surrounds us every day. Most gypsum in the United States is used to make wallboard for homes, offices, and commercial buildings; a typical new American home contains more than 7 metric tons of gypsum alone. Relation to Mining. IMAR 7 th Edition. Most of the world''s gypsum is produced by surfacemining operations. In the United States, gypsum is mined in about 19 states. The states producing the most gypsum are Oklahoma, Iowa, Nevada, Texas, and California.

A flow diagram for a typical gypsum process producing both crude and finished gypsum products is shown in Figure In this process gypsum is crushed, dried, ground, and calcined. Not all of the operations shown in Figure are performed at all gypsum plants. Some plants produce only wallboard, and many plants do not produce soil ...
